Highlights of the Itinerary

Catemaco And Los Tuxtlas Tour From Veracruz Or Boca Del Rio - Highlights of the Itinerary

The tour begins with hotel pickup at 8:00 AM, setting the stage for a day of exploration in the Catemaco and Los Tuxtlas region.

Travelers first visit Santiago Tuxtla, where they can marvel at the largest head found in the area.

From there, the group proceeds to the stunning El Salto de Eyipantla waterfall, a natural wonder that showcases the region’s captivating beauty.

The itinerary then takes participants on a boat trip along the river in Catemaco, allowing them to enjoy the town’s vibrant atmosphere and soak in the picturesque surroundings.
